Oldham
Offerton
Offerton
Greater Manchester
Manchester
Manchester
Manchester
Broughton, City and Borough of Salford
Manchester
Macclesfield
Urmston
Urmston
Manchester
Barton upon Irwell
Barton upon Irwell
Manchester
Manchester
Greater Manchester
Greater Manchester
Openshaw
Sale
Sale
Openshaw
Salford
Salford
Manchester
Manchester
Bolton
Openshaw
Manchester
Sale
Manchester
Manchester
Manchester
Broughton, City and Borough of Salford
Broughton, City and Borough of Salford
Hazel Grove
Hazel Grove
Manchester
Bolton